Transaction 7786cafd36edc215e5d9df375d55cc9879ee56565117f48d0bb28e91d9a5f907

1 Input
2 Outputs
  • 7786cafd36edc215e5d9df375d55cc9879ee56565117f48d0bb28e91d9a5f907:0
  • value  14713750
    address  3KJfkVDfdqQrecMjAzJ9M2VkPhrjiFskMU
  • 7786cafd36edc215e5d9df375d55cc9879ee56565117f48d0bb28e91d9a5f907:1
  • value  983598
    address  1JDyeeoSrd24ZCtggX1xs46LcSh2WdvxJE